||||
原则上,只要能方便地进行数据的三维显示,很多研究工作中的困难就可以迎刃而解,而不必想各种办法进行数据显示。
数据三维显示的基本想法是在三维空间画三维数据的等值面,找到合适的等值面就可以展示出三维数据中包含的重要信息。用matlab实现三维数据的显示是比较简单的,比之前尝试用IDL还简单一些。重要的是,matlab画出图后可以方便地对图进行旋转等操作,而不像IDL那样要改参数重新执行。当然,和IDL一样,matlab对大一些的数据也是无能为力的,收到电脑内存的限制。要显示一个100平方度天区的$^{13}$CO是无法实现的,要像NASA那样显示整个银河系的数据,那就更是天方夜谭了。数据的三维显示,程序是简单的,但是要建立一个可用的系统是不容易的。
Archiver|手机版|科学网 ( 京ICP备07017567号-12 )
GMT+8, 2024-5-19 06:53
Powered by ScienceNet.cn
Copyright © 2007- 中国科学报社